Lake Chelan - Chelan, WA
Lake Information
| Surface Area: | 135000 acres |
| Shoreline: | 109.2 miles |
| Maximum Depth: | 1486 ft. |
| Capacity: | 15800000 acre ft. |
| Elevation: | 1098 ft. |
| Fish Species: | Chinook Salmon, Cutthroat Trout, Rainbow Trout, Brook Trout, Mackinaw Trout, Kokanee Salmon, Mountain Whitefish, Bull Trout |
Lake Chelan, a majestic and profoundly deep glacier-fed lake in North Central Washington, stretching over 50 miles, presents a premier, year-round coldwater fishery. Its vastness and impressive depths make it a prime destination for robust Lake Trout (Mackinaw), often weighing substantial amounts. Anglers primarily pursue these formidable fish through specialized deepwater trolling with downriggers, using large attractors and bait, with spring, fall, and winter offering consistent action.
Access to Lake Chelan is excellent, with numerous public boat launches available in Chelan and Manson. Guided fishing charters are readily available and highly recommended, especially for first-time visitors or those looking to maximize their success, as local guides possess invaluable knowledge of the lake's intricate depths and fish patterns. These charters often provide all necessary specialized equipment. Shoreline access is somewhat limited due to the steep terrain in many areas, but certain public parks and resort areas offer opportunities for bank fishing.
The lake also boasts thriving populations of Kokanee Salmon, providing lively light-tackle opportunities, particularly in spring and summer through shallow trolling with small lures. Additionally, large Chinook Salmon are present, offering a thrilling challenge through similar deepwater methods as for Mackinaw. Rainbow and Westslope Cutthroat Trout offer further diverse angling, often targeted closer to shore with conventional casting gear.
Anglers should always consult the latest Washington Department of Fish and Wildlife (WDFW) regulations for Lake Chelan, as specific seasons, size limits, and bag limits can vary by species and are subject to change. Given the unique challenges and incredible rewards of this vast lake, a well-planned trip to Lake Chelan promises a memorable and potentially trophy-worthy fishing adventure in a stunning natural setting.
